一种开关磁阻电机限频率电流控制方法

         

摘要

A current control method suitable for switched reluctance motor was proposed. On the one hand, the method can limit maximal chop frequency,on the other hand, avoid loss of voltage brought about by unnecessary chopper. Firstly, the basic principles of the method was introduced, then the characteristics of the method was analyzed, and made simulation with Matlab/Simulink. Finally introduced the implement thinking of the current controller used CPLD. The results show that the current control method is stable and has small current fluctuations, can reduce the switching loss, enhance the switched reluctance motor drive(SRD) dynam-ic property effectively,%提出了一种适用于开关磁阻电机的电流控制方法.该方法一方面限制斩波的最高频率,另一方面能避免不必要的斩波带来的电压损失.首先介绍了该方法的基本原理,然后对该方法的特性进行了分析,并在Matlab/Simulink中做了仿真.最后介绍了用CPLD实现该方法的思路.结果表明,该电流控制方法稳定性好,电流波动小,能有效降低开关损耗、提高开关磁阻电机调速系统的动态性能.
